Wydanie 4 tygodnika Amarok:
- Okładki albumów w edytorze kolekcji
- "Uaktualnij" kontra "Przeszukaj ponownie"
- Ulepszenia interfejsu
- Ostatnie zmiany
- Test Coverity
- Tips: Synchronizacja globalnych tagów z Last.fm
Okładki albumów w edytorze kolekcji
Według ogłoszenia na liście mailingowej Amaroka, został nałożony nowy patch (post Marka):
Patch wyświetla okładki albumów w edytorze kolekcji. Jest to eksperymentalny patach stworzony przez Trevera Fischer. Myślę, że jest to całkiem fajne rozwiązanie. Może jednak powinniśmy ograniczyć rozmiar obrazka?
Tutaj znajduję się zrzut ekranu prezentujący tą opcję w aktualnym stanie:

Obrazki są wyświetlane tylko przy rozwiniętych albumach, dzięki czemu nie zajmują one zbyt wiele miejsca.
"Uaktualnij" kontra "Przeszukaj ponownie"
Programiści Amaroka dodali w końcu długo oczekiwaną funkcję do "skanera" kolekcji. Pojawiła się możliwość ręcznego uruchomienia "skanowania przyrostowego", czyli uaktualniania kolekcji. Zrzut ekranu:

Jeff Mitchell wyjaśnił:
Uaktualnianie wykonuje skanowanie przyrostowe - przeszukuje tylko te katalogi w których zostały dodane lub usunięte jakieś pliki (lub też zmieniły się ich nazwy). Opcja "Przeszukaj ponownie" przeszukuje całą kolekcję.
Andrew Turner dodaje:
Warto zauważyć, że funkcja "Uaktualnij" jest dokładnie tym, co było dokonywane, jeśli użytkownik zaznaczył w konfiguracji "Śledź zmiany w katalogach"[…].
Ulepszenia interfejsu
Wraz z rozwojem programu dokonywane są także pewne ulepszenie wizualne. Gwiazdki notowań, które w poprzednim wydaniu AWN otrzymały nowe kolory, teraz wyglądają jeszcze lepiej:

Okno etykiet plików zyskało nowy wygląd:

Ostatnie zmiany
Patche dodające przeszukiwanie tekstu piosenek (Carles Pina i Estany), obsługę programu yauapp (Sascha Sommer) oraz suwaka głośności w dymkach OSD (Alexander Bechikov) zostały zaakceptowane. Nie wszystkie z nich znajdą się w wersji 1.4.5, ale wszystkie z nich są w pełni funkcjonalne i są testowane w SVN.
Test Coverity
Coverity jest firmą, która oferuje zautomatyzowane narzędzia do analizy kodu źródłowego. Ostatnio zaoferowali różnym projektom Open Source darmowe analizy kodu.
Erik Hovland poinformował developerów projektu Amarok o wynikach analizy jego kodu:
Chciałem poinformować, że testy kodu Amaroka zostały zakończone z całkiem niezłym wynikiem.
Wykryto pewne błędy m.in w sqlite o których będę rozmawiał z developerami sqlite.
Poprawki, które zostaną wprowadzone po testach, będą niewielkie i uczynią Amaroka bardziej stabilnym.
Na ile czas pozwoli, chciałbym co jakiś czas przeprowadzać takie analizy kodu Amaroka, jednak raczej nie będzie się to odbywało zbyt regularnie.
[…]
Tips: Synchronizacja globalnych tagów z Last.fm
Od czasu kiedy Amarok ma wsparcie dla tagowania muzyki, wielu użytkowników zastanawiało się, czy pojawi się możliwość wykorzystania tagów z Last.fm w Amaroku. Jest jednak rozwiązanie: skrypt synctags. Opis ze strony domowej:
Skrypt synctags pobiera Globalne Tagi z last.fm podczas zmiany piosenek lub dla piosenek wybranych z listy odtwarzania. Tagi są dodawane jako etykiety w Amaroku.
